Well, file this under sucks...

 

I managed to break one of the mounts for my Las Cannons on my Land Raider.  The peg that the weapon is supposed to pivot on.  Trying to figure out how to fix it, as it was lodged in the hole and had to be destroyed to get it out.  

 

Will try to figure this out.  Oh well.  Other than that we're on track to complete before the Holiday.

 

Paul

Link to comment
Share on other sites

Maybe drill it our and use a metal rod of the right size? It wouldn't break as easily.

 

I looked into this, but the mount is an odd size, and doesn't translate to Metric or SAE normal sizes.  I put it on the Caliper to check.  I ended up filling the gun side with Greenstuff and letting it cure over night, then drilled a new hole for a steel pin and mounted it through to the other side.  you can tell that it's a *little* off, but it's holding up okay for now.  Mainly it's in changing the yaw, pitch works just fine.
